Mackerel rillettes Recipe


Put 200g smoked mackerel filets and the juice of 1/3 lemon in a food processor, blend smooth, then fold in 65g creme fraiche, 65g cream cheese and 10g creamed horseradish sauce, and chill.

Next, make the pickle. Put 4 tbsp rice vinegar, 2 tbsp water, 40g caster sugar and a pinch of salt in a small saucepan and heat gently, swirling the pan, until the salt and sugar dissolve. Take off the heat and leave to cool.

Mix 1/3 cucumber, quartered lengthways, deseeded and cut into 5mm-thin slices, 1/4 small red onion, thinly sliced, 1/3 red chilli, cut into thin rounds, 1/3 tbsp grated ginger and 1/3 tbsp coriander leaves in a bowl, then pour in the cold pickle liquid and leave to marinate for five minutes.

Toast 2 thick slices sourdough and put it on a platter. Spoon some mackerel rillettes alongside , followed by a mound of the pickle, and serve.
